Movement And Mechanics

At the heart of the A. Lange & Söhne Lange 1 25th Anniversary beats the L121.1 caliber offering a 72-hour power reserve running at 21,600 vph with 43 jewels. The Rolex Sky-Dweller 326935 Black Dial is powered by the Rolex 9001 with a 72-hour power reserve operating at 28,800 vph featuring 40 jewels. Both watches offer identical power reserves, making them equally practical for daily rotation.

Dimensions And Wearability

The A. Lange & Söhne Lange 1 25th Anniversary features a 38.5mm case at 10.7mm thick with a 45.0mm lug-to-lug measurement, crafted in 18k White Gold. The Rolex Sky-Dweller 326935 Black Dial comes in at 42.0mm and 14.1mm thick with 50.0mm lug-to-lug, constructed from 18k Everose Gold. The A. Lange & Söhne Lange 1 25th Anniversary wears more compactly on the wrist, making it potentially more suitable for smaller wrists or those who prefer understated proportions. At 72g, the A. Lange & Söhne Lange 1 25th Anniversary is the lighter of the two.

Materials And Construction

The A. Lange & Söhne Lange 1 25th Anniversary uses a Sapphire crystal paired with a Fixed bezel, while the Rolex Sky-Dweller 326935 Black Dial features Sapphire with Cyclops lens crystal with a Fluted Command bezel, 18k Everose Gold bezel. On the wrist, the A. Lange & Söhne Lange 1 25th Anniversary comes on a Leather strap with Buckle, while the Rolex Sky-Dweller 326935 Black Dial is fitted with Oysterflex rubber strap featuring Oysterlock folding clasp.

Water Resistance And Capability

The A. Lange & Söhne Lange 1 25th Anniversary is rated to 30m / 98ft and the Rolex Sky-Dweller 326935 Black Dial to 100m / 328ft. For water sports and diving, the Rolex Sky-Dweller 326935 Black Dial provides superior depth capability.

Pricing And Value

At retail, the A. Lange & Söhne Lange 1 25th Anniversary lists for $43,500 compared to $43,250 for the Rolex Sky-Dweller 326935 Black Dial. On the secondary market, the A. Lange & Söhne Lange 1 25th Anniversary trades around $37,000 while the Rolex Sky-Dweller 326935 Black Dial commands approximately $47,000. The Rolex Sky-Dweller 326935 Black Dial carries a 9% market premium.
